| Part Number | 51405038-376 |
| Input Channels | 16 differential analog inputs |
| Signal Types | ±10V, 0-10V, 0-5V, 1-5V, 4-20mA (configurable per channel) |
| A/D Conversion | 16-bit resolution (65,536 counts) |
| Accuracy | ±0.1% of full scale @ 25°C |
| Update Rate | 100ms per channel (configurable) |
| HART Protocol | Supported on all 16 channels |
| Isolation Voltage | 1500V DC channel-to-bus |
| Operating Range | 0°C to 60°C (32°F to 140°F) |
| Storage Range | -40°C to 85°C (-40°F to 185°F) |
| Humidity | 5% to 95% non-condensing |
| Power Draw | 5W typical, 7W maximum |
| Certifications | CE, UL508, CSA C22.2, ATEX Zone 2 |
| MTBF | >150,000 hours @ 40°C |

Can the CC-PAIH02 interface with third-party DCS platforms outside the Honeywell ecosystem?
The module is optimized for Honeywell control systems. Third-party integration may require protocol converters or gateway devices. Contact our technical team with your specific platform details for compatibility assessment and integration architecture recommendations.
What is the maximum cable distance between field transmitters and the CC-PAIH02 module?
For 4-20mA current loops, standard practice allows up to 1000 meters (3280 feet) with appropriate wire gauge. HART communication remains functional across the same distance, though signal quality should be verified during commissioning for runs exceeding 500 meters.
Does the module support intrinsically safe (IS) field devices in hazardous area applications?
The CC-PAIH02 itself is not IS-rated. For hazardous area installations, use approved IS barriers or galvanic isolators between the module and field devices. The module's isolation architecture is compatible with most barrier technologies.
How does the hot-swap capability work during module replacement?
The system automatically detects module removal and insertion. Upon installation, the replacement module reads its configuration from the controller's database and resumes operation within 2-3 seconds. No manual re-configuration is required if replacing with an identical module type.
What preventive maintenance is recommended for the CC-PAIH02?
The module is solid-state with no moving parts, requiring minimal maintenance. Annual verification of calibration accuracy is recommended for critical measurement loops. HART diagnostics should be reviewed quarterly to identify sensor drift or wiring degradation before failures occur.
Can I mix voltage and current inputs on the same module?
Yes, each of the 16 channels is independently configurable via software. You can simultaneously monitor voltage transmitters on channels 1-8 and current transmitters on channels 9-16 without hardware modifications or jumper changes.
